The oceanic manta ray lives in a large marine habitat with many different fish species. This makes a rich and diverse ecosystem. These ecosystems are usually in warm waters. They are home to some types of sharks, like the reef shark and the whale shark. These sharks are gentle filter feeders, like the manta rays. Brightly colored reef fish, such as butterflyfish, parrotfish, and angelfish, live in the coral reefs and cleaning stations. Manta rays often stop at these cleaning stations to get parasites removed by smaller fish. There are also big predators, like groupers and barracudas, that eat smaller fish. Sea turtles, tuna, and dolphins also share this environment. They all play important roles in keeping the balance of marine life.
